Heim >Backend-Entwicklung >PHP-Problem >Was soll ich tun, wenn die Funktion mysql_connect() in PHP nicht unterstützt wird?
Methode: 1. Öffnen Sie die Datei „php.ini“. 2. Suchen Sie nach „pdo_mysql“ und „curl“ und löschen Sie das „;“ vor „;extension=php_curl.dll“ und „;extension=pdo_mysql“. .dll"; 3. Starten Sie den Apache-Server neu.
Die Betriebsumgebung dieses Tutorials: Windows10-System, MySQL8.0.22-Version, Dell G3-Computer.
Die Funktion mysql_connect() ist eine Funktion, die PHP mit der MySQL-Datenbank verbindet. Wenn Ihr PHP die Funktion mysql_connect() nicht unterstützt, bedeutet dies, dass Ihre Datenbank kann nicht mit MySQL verbunden werden. Lassen Sie mich im Folgenden die Methoden zur Lösung des Problems zusammenfassen, dass mysql_connect() nicht verwendet werden kann.
Mysql_connect() wird nicht unterstützt, da die PHP-Erweiterung nicht richtig konfiguriert ist.
1. Öffnen Sie die php.ini-Datei:2 Curl
;extension=php_curl.dll
;extension=pdo_mysql.dll
Dann entfernen Sie das „;“ vor den beiden;
Die Datei libmysql.dll fehlt im System32-Verzeichnis (C:/windows/system32). Die Lösung besteht darin, libmysql.dll im zu finden php-Verzeichnis und ersetzen Sie libmysql.dll. Kopieren Sie es in das Verzeichnis C:/windows/system32 und starten Sie den Webdienst neu.
In der Datei php.ini im Verzeichnis C:/windows wurde das erste „;“ in „;extension=php_mysql.dll“ nicht entfernt, daher kann die entsprechende Funktion nicht verwendet werden. Die Lösung besteht darin, die PHP-Datei zu öffnen .ini-Datei und finden Sie sie. ;extension=php_mysql.dll Wechseln Sie zu
extension=php_mysql.dll //去掉前面的;使之生效3. Starten Sie den iis- oder Apache-Server neu.
Empfohlenes Lernen:
MySQL-Video-TutorialDas obige ist der detaillierte Inhalt vonWas soll ich tun, wenn die Funktion mysql_connect() in PHP nicht unterstützt wird?.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!